STD Testing Lab Locations Site Map > Labs By State > California > Davis 635 Anderson RdSuite 3 Davis, CA 95616 2330 West Covell Blvd Davis, CA 95616
STD labs by City Site Map > Labs By State > California > Davis 635 Anderson RdSuite 3 Davis, CA 95616 2330 West Covell Blvd Davis, CA 95616